Former Maharashtra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is tests positive for COVID-19

Salil Urunkar

Former Chief Minister of Maharashtra Devendra Fadnavis tested positive for COVID-19 on Saturday. The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) leader took to Twitter to address his followers and request those who came in contact with him to stay in isolation.

In his tweet, Fadnavis wrote, "I have been working every single day since the lockdown but now it seems that God wants me to stop for a while and take a break! I have tested #COVID19 positive and in isolation."

He also mentioned how he has been advised medication and isolation by doctors. “Those who have come in contact with me are advised to get covid19 tests done. Take care, everyone !,” he has said in a follow-up tweet. He is currently in-charge of the party's Bihar state election campaign.

On Wednesday evening,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ar had also some symptoms of the Covid-19 but he had tested negative for the coronavirus infection. Still, Pawar has isolated himself and has been working from his official residence 'Devgiri' in Mumbai.
